Shoulder Dystocia

This course has been developed in partnership with IntelliLearn out of many years of presentations, workshops and on-line activities involving midwives, obstetricians, GP's and students.

This course covers key areas of Shoulder Dystocia including its definition, associated conditions, and management. Upon successful completion of the associated quiz, 1 Australian College of Midwives (MidPLUS) points will be awarded.

Learning Outcomes

On completion of this course you should be able to:

  • anticipate and recognise shoulder dystocia accurately and in a timely manner
  • demonstrate on a mannequin an appropriate approach to the management of shoulder dystocia
  • use the Resource Materials and feedback aspect of the self test facilities to ensure a satisfactory understanding of the key issues relating to shoulder dystocia
  • achieve an appropriate score in the corresponding quiz allowing the printing of a certificate of quiz completion
  • be aware of the essential requirements for appropriate case note documentation of the management of shoulder dystocia, and
  • use the information in this module to prepare for your own clinical competency assessment.
